If
you want to register an Australian Domain Name, these
rules will apply. During the registration process, you
will be required to meet the following requirements.
.COM.AU -/- .NET.AU
To
own a .com.au or .net.au you must be an Australian registered
company, or business with a registered business number
(ABN, BRN, BN).
The domain name you order should have a solid relationship
to the business it represents.
For
example:-
Mazda
Motor Company would be reasonably entitled to own:
www.mazdacars.com.au
www.mazda.com.au
www.zoomzoom.com.au
www.cars.com.au

.ORG.AU / .ASN.AU
To
qualify for these domains your organisation must be
a "non-commercial organisation".
The
domain name you register should have a solid relationship
to the organisation to which it represents.
For
example:-
Red
Cross are reasonably entitled to own:-
www.redcross.org.au
www.rdhelp.org.au

.ID.AU
Especially
designed for individuals, who reside in Australia.
You
may register ANY personal name by which you are known.
For
example:-
John
Paul would be reasonably entitled to own:-
www.john-paul.id.au
www.littlejohn.id.au
www.JBoy.id.au
